Lean Six Sigma: Accelerating Factory Operational Excellence
Lean Six Sigma: Accelerating Factory Operational Excellence
Blog Article
This methodology represents a significant blend of two established process improvement techniques. It helps producers to radically reduce defects and fluctuations in their operations, ultimately leading to enhanced productivity, minimized expenses, and increased customer satisfaction. By combining Lean’s focus on cutting unnecessary activities with Six Sigma’s quantitative techniques for error control, firms can realize marked benefits in their manufacturing setting.
